排序
使用前端标签实现静态文件(如Excel、Word、PDF)下载的方法与注意事项
在前端使用<a>标签实现静态资源文件(如Excel、Word、PDF等)的下载是一种简单而常用的方法。这种方法依赖于服务器端正确设置了文件的MIME类型(Content-Type)以及如果需要的话,还设置了Co...
MyBatis SQL片段复用技巧与实践指南
MyBatis中SQL片段复用主要通过<sql>标签和<include>标签来实现,以下是这两种标签的详细使用方法: 一、<sql>标签 <sql>标签用于定义一个可以复用的SQL片段。这些片段可以是...
Android 获取定位信息的工具类实现
下面是一个完整的 Android 定位工具类实现,支持 GPS 和网络定位,兼容 Android 10 (API 29) 及以上版本的权限管理,并提供简洁的 API 供调用。 一、工具类代码实现 import android.Manifest; i...
mysql常用语句与函数大全及举例
下面给你整理一份 MySQL 常用语句与函数大全及举例,涵盖 DDL、DML、DQL、DCL、常用函数(字符串、数值、日期、聚合、流程控制等),并附带简单示例,方便查阅与实战参考。 一、数据库与表...
精通Java并发:揭秘StampedLock的高效应用与实战技巧
实现原理 StampedLock 是 Java 8 引入的一种新的锁机制,旨在读多写少的场景下提供更高的并发性能。其核心在于使用一个 64 位的 long 类型变量来维护锁的状态,该状态不仅表示锁是否被持有,还...
使用JavaScript轻松生成二维码
在JavaScript中生成二维码,你通常会使用一个专门的库,比如qrcode.js或者qrcode-generator。以下是一个使用qrcode.js的简单示例: 安装 qrcode.js 如果你在使用Node.js环境,你可以通过npm来安...
如何安全地在Telegram(电报)上注销账户:详细步骤与注意事项
Telegram(电报)账户的注销可以通过手机端和网页端两种方式进行。以下是详细的操作步骤: 手机端注销Telegram账户 打开Telegram应用:首先,确保你的Telegram应用是最新版本,并在手机上打开它...
Node.js中的高效缓存策略与实用技巧
在Node.js中,缓存是一个重要的优化策略,可以帮助减少数据库查询、网络请求等开销,从而显著提高应用程序的性能。以下是一些在Node.js中使用的缓存策略和技巧: 1. 内存缓存 Node.js应用程序可...









